Turkey Burger with Guacamole (Printable)

Tender turkey patties combined with creamy, zesty guacamole for a fresh and flavorful main dish.

# What You'll Need:

→ Turkey Burgers

01 - 1 lb lean ground turkey
02 - 1 small onion, finely chopped
03 - 2 cloves garlic, minced
04 - 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
05 - 1 tsp smoked paprika
06 - 1/2 tsp ground cumin
07 - 1/2 tsp salt
08 - 1/4 tsp black pepper
09 - 1 tbsp olive oil (for cooking)

→ Guacamole

10 - 2 ripe avocados
11 - 1 small tomato, seeded and finely diced
12 - 1/4 small red onion, finely diced
13 - 1 small jalapeño, seeded and minced (optional)
14 - 2 tbsp fresh cilantro, chopped
15 - Juice of 1 lime
16 - 1/4 tsp salt
17 - Freshly ground black pepper, to taste

→ For Serving

18 - 4 burger buns
19 - Lettuce leaves
20 - Sliced tomato
21 - Sliced red onion

# Directions:

01 - In a mixing bowl, combine ground turkey, chopped onion, minced garlic, chopped parsley, smoked paprika, cumin, salt, and black pepper. Mix gently until ingredients are just blended.
02 - Divide the mixture into four equal portions and shape each into a patty.
03 - Heat olive oil in a skillet or grill pan over medium heat. Cook patties 5 to 6 minutes on each side until golden brown and internal temperature reaches 165°F. Remove from heat and allow to rest briefly.
04 - In a bowl, mash avocados until mostly smooth. Fold in diced tomato, red onion, minced jalapeño if using, chopped cilantro, lime juice, salt, and black pepper. Adjust seasoning as desired.
05 - Lightly toast burger buns if preferred.
06 - Place lettuce leaves on bottom buns, add turkey patties, top each with a generous spoonful of guacamole, sliced tomato, and sliced red onion. Cover with top bun halves.
07 - Serve immediately while warm.

02 -
  • Don't press down on the patties while they cook—every time you do, you're squeezing out the juices that keep them tender and flavorful.
  • Make the guacamole close to serving time and cover it with plastic wrap pressed directly onto the surface to prevent browning if you need to wait.
03 -
  • Cook the turkey patties over medium heat, not high—they'll cook through evenly and stay juicy instead of getting a charred outside with a dry center.
  • If your avocados aren't quite ripe, a pinch of sugar in the guacamole wakes up the flavor and balances any green tannins.
